Understanding Title Loan Hardship Programs
Title loan hardship programs are designed to offer relief to borrowers who find themselves in financial distress while repaying their loans. These programs recognize that life throws curveballs, and unexpected events can significantly impact a borrower’s ability to meet their repayment obligations. Whether it’s a sudden medical emergency, job loss, or an unforeseen legal issue, these programs provide a safety net by offering various options to help borrowers manage their debt. Understanding these programs is crucial for anyone considering a title loan, especially in challenging economic times.
In the case of a Dallas Title Loan, for instance, hardship programs may include loan extensions, which provide borrowers with additional time to repay without incurring penalties or interest charges. Quick funding, another aspect these programs address, can help bridge the gap during financial crises, ensuring individuals have access to emergency cash when it matters most. By taking advantage of such initiatives, borrowers can maintain their financial stability and avoid defaulting on their loans.
Eligibility Criteria for These Programs
To qualify for Title Loan Hardship Programs, borrowers must meet specific eligibility criteria set by participating lenders and financial institutions. These programs are designed to offer relief to individuals facing financial hardships, often related to unforeseen circumstances such as job loss, medical emergencies, or natural disasters. One key requirement is demonstrating a substantial decline in income due to these challenges. This could involve providing proof of unemployment, reduced work hours, or medical bills that have significantly impacted one’s financial stability.
Additionally, lenders typically assess the value and condition of the borrower’s vehicle, as Car Title Loans are often a primary source of emergency funding. Individuals must own a vehicle with a clear title and sufficient equity to secure the loan. The program’s scope may also include requirements for proof of residency, age limitations (usually 18 or older), and a clean credit history, emphasizing that these measures ensure responsible lending practices in Debt Consolidation efforts.
